Red Hat Security Advisory

Synopsis: Moderate: Red Hat Single Sign-On 7.5.2 security update on RHEL 7
Advisory ID: RHSA-2022:1711-01
Product: Red Hat Single Sign-On
Advisory URL: https://access.redhat.com/errata/RHSA-2022:1711
Issue date: 2022-05-04
CVE Names: CVE-2022-1245
====================================================================
1. Summary:

New Red Hat Single Sign-On 7.5.2 packages are now available for Red Hat
Enterprise Linux 7.

Red Hat Product Security has rated this update as having a security impact
of Moderate. A Common Vulnerability Scoring System (CVSS) base score, which
gives a detailed severity rating, is available for each vulnerability from
the CVE link(s) in the References section.

2. Relevant releases/architectures:

Red Hat Single Sign-On 7.5 for RHEL 7 Server - noarch

3. Description:

Red Hat Single Sign-On 7.5 is a standalone server, based on the Keycloak
project, that provides authentication and standards-based single sign-on
capabilities for web and mobile applications.

This release of Red Hat Single Sign-On 7.5.2 on RHEL 7 serves as a security
patch for Red Hat Single Sign-On 7.5.2, and includes bug fixes and
enhancements, which are documented in the Release Notes document linked to
in the References.

Security Fix(es):

* keycloak: Privilege escalation vulnerability on Token Exchange
(CVE-2022-1245)

For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S
score,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in
the References section.
